JavaScript Type Conversions - W3Schools
Converting Strings to Numbers. The global method Number() converts a variable (or a value) into a number. A numeric string (like "3.14") converts to a number (like 3.14). An empty string (like "") converts to 0. A non numeric string (like "John") converts to NaN (Not a Number).

What's the fastest way to convert String to Number in JavaScript?
7 ways to convert a String to Number: let str = "43.2" 1. Number(str) => 43.2 2. parseInt(str) => 43 3. parseFloat(str) => 43.2 4. +str => 43 5. str * 1 => 43.2 6. Math.floor(str) => 43 7. ~~str => 43
